> I have been advised to use SID for simulating a
> device, but i was wonderig if SID is available for
> Windows too and where i could find the complete
> application without building it by myself.
SID should build and run OK under the cygwin environment
(http://sources.redhat.com/cygwin/) on Windows. I confess I have not tried
it. However, you will have to build it yourself as there are no pre-built
binaries for Windows. This is not normally a problem to do - there have been
posts on the SID mailing lists
(http://sources.redhat.com/ml/sid/2002-q3/msg00093.html) confirming that
this has been done successfully.
